Featured July 26 @ 11:00 am–1:00 pm

Vintage Baseball Game

Roger Maestas Field 60 Beckers Lane, Manitou Springs, CO, United States

Come cheer the home team or have a good laugh over a Vintage Baseball Game using 1864 rules! See America’s Pastime as it was played in the Colorado Territory over 150 years ago. It’s the Colorado Vintage Base Ball Association vs. the Manitou Springers located at Roger Maestas Field 60 Beckers Lane in Manitou Springs. […]

History Coalition
Featured July 28 @ 10:00 am

Pikes Peak History Coalition Meeting (Private Event)

Manitou Springs Heritage Museum 517 Manitou Avenue, Manitou Springs, CO, United States

Regular meeting of the Pikes Peak History Coalition. The Coalition was started in 2002 to promote the history of the Pikes Peak region. There are currently 24 museums and historical societies in the Coalition, including our Manitou Springs Heritage Museum. Learn more.
